David, I wondered if the catalogue numbering might be a giveaway, but those stamps must be from the 1966 Kenya animals series, where SG and Scott share similar (or the same) numbering. If it was Kenya Uganda Tanganyika, then Scott 32 would be the 3-shilling black, which is too valuable for that packet at that price.

In short, I don't think the numbers are a clue. (The company name looks UK to me, for what its worth.)
